SCHEDULE 13D: CR Financial Holdings Boosts Stake in Roth CH Acquisition Co. to 46.8% Through Share Acquisition and Debt Conversion

CR Financial Holdings, Inc. has significantly increased its beneficial ownership in Roth CH Acquisition Co. to 46.8% through a combination of share acquisition and conversion of a promissory note.

Capital raiseCR Financial Holdings, Inc. and certain other entities converted a promissory note, under which they had previously lent money to the Issuer, into 19,064,58 ordinary shares on January 24, 2025. This conversion represents a change in the company's capital structure from debt to equity.

Summary

  • CR Financial Holdings, Inc. (CR Financial) reported beneficial ownership of 21,184,395 Class A Ordinary Shares of Roth CH Acquisition Co.
  • This ownership represents 46.8% of the Issuer's outstanding Class A Ordinary Shares.
  • The increase in ownership resulted from two primary transactions: an initial acquisition of 2,127,937 ordinary shares using working capital, and the conversion of a promissory note into an additional 19,064,58 ordinary shares on January 24, 2025.
  • The promissory note conversion involved CR Financial and certain other entities that had lent money to the Issuer.
  • CR Financial states that the acquisition of these securities is for investment purposes.
  • The reporting persons currently have no plans or proposals for extraordinary corporate transactions, changes in the board of directors or management, material changes in capitalization or dividend policy, or other significant alterations to the Company's business or corporate structure.
  • However, CR Financial reserves the right to acquire additional securities, or to retain or sell all or a portion of its current holdings in the open market or through privately negotiated transactions.

Related Party Transactions

  • CR Financial Holdings, Inc., Byron Roth, and Gordon Roth are all reporting persons in this filing. CR Financial Holdings, Inc. and 'certain other entities' (which include Byron Roth and Gordon Roth as beneficial owners) lent money to the Issuer via a promissory note, which was subsequently converted into shares. This indicates a transaction between related parties.
